Is Zero a Digit?Date: 9/3/95 at 21:4:6 From: Anonymous Subject: Zero?? Hello again! New question...is zero considered a digit? I think so, but there has been much discussion in my class! I certainly do appreciate all your help! Thanks
Date: 9/4/95 at 11:51:22
From: Doctor Ken
Subject: Re: Zero??
Hello!
Yes, zero is a digit. It's a really really important digit! A digit is
anything that you can write down in your expression of a number in
regular notation. So since zero shows up in numbers like 307, and 10,
and even 0, zero is a digit.
